2. File Integrity

In the context of obtaining a “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file for the PlayStation 3, file integrity refers to the assurance that the downloaded file is complete, uncorrupted, and identical to the original source file. Compromised file integrity can lead to a non-functional game, system instability, or the introduction of malicious software.

  • Definition of File Integrity in the Digital Realm

    File integrity encompasses the guarantee that data remains unchanged during transfer and storage. Verification mechanisms, such as checksums, are used to confirm that the data received is identical to the data sent. A successful check ensures that no accidental alterations have occurred during the download process, which is vital for the correct functionality of the game.

  • Checksum Verification

    Checksums, like MD5 or SHA hashes, are unique fingerprints generated from the content of a file. Before installing the game, a user can calculate the checksum of the downloaded “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file and compare it to the checksum provided by a trusted source (if available). If the checksums match, it strongly indicates that the file has not been altered or corrupted during the download process. A mismatch suggests a compromised file, necessitating a new download from a different source.

  • Potential Causes of File Corruption

    Numerous factors can lead to file corruption during download. Interrupted internet connections, errors in the data transfer protocol, faulty storage devices, or even malware infections can alter the contents of the file. These alterations may render the “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file unusable, resulting in installation errors or game crashes. It is crucial to use a stable internet connection and reliable download manager to mitigate these risks.

  • Implications for System Stability and Security

    A corrupted “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file may contain incomplete or erroneous code, potentially leading to system instability on the PlayStation 3. In more severe cases, a tampered file could harbor malicious code, allowing unauthorized access to the console or the compromise of user data. Downloading and installing files from untrusted sources significantly increases the risk of these security breaches, underscoring the importance of verifying file integrity before installation.

The verification of file integrity is an indispensable step when obtaining a “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file. It guards against incomplete or corrupted files and mitigates the risk of malware infections, ensuring the proper functioning of the game and the security of the PlayStation 3 console. Neglecting this step exposes the user to potential software malfunctions and security vulnerabilities.

5. Console modification

The successful utilization of a “Fight Night Round 4” PS3 PKG download often hinges on console modification. The PlayStation 3, in its original factory configuration, is designed to only install software and games digitally signed by Sony, the console’s manufacturer. A PKG file obtained from unofficial sources lacks this official signature. Consequently, to install and play such a file, the console typically requires modification. This modification commonly involves installing custom firmware (CFW) or exploiting existing vulnerabilities to bypass the security measures that prevent the installation of unsigned PKG files. Without such modification, the PlayStation 3 will refuse to install the downloaded game, rendering the effort to obtain it futile. This highlights the critical dependency of using unofficial game files on altering the console’s intended operational parameters.

The process of console modification carries inherent risks. Modifying the PlayStation 3 voids the manufacturer’s warranty and can potentially brick the console, rendering it inoperable. Furthermore, installing CFW or exploiting vulnerabilities may introduce security vulnerabilities that could be exploited by malicious actors. For instance, a poorly designed CFW could inadvertently disable security features, making the console more susceptible to malware or unauthorized access. The potential benefits of playing “Fight Night Round 4” from a downloaded PKG file must be weighed against these tangible risks. The complexity of the modification process also varies considerably, ranging from relatively straightforward CFW installations to more intricate hardware modifications. Each method has its own set of prerequisites and potential pitfalls, demanding careful research and technical expertise. A user who attempts to install CFW without adequately understanding the process risks causing irreversible damage to their console, emphasizing the need for caution and informed decision-making.

In conclusion, console modification forms an integral, yet risky, component in the process of utilizing a “Fight Night Round 4” PS3 PKG download from unofficial sources. The act of altering the console’s firmware is often a prerequisite for installation, but it comes with potential consequences including voided warranties, bricked consoles, and increased security vulnerabilities. The decision to modify a PlayStation 3 to play downloaded game files requires careful consideration of these risks and benefits. The user must possess the technical skills to execute the modification safely and responsibly. Otherwise, the desired outcome of playing “Fight Night Round 4” could result in a non-functional console, creating a far less desirable outcome.

6. Copyright concerns

The pursuit of a “Fight Night Round 4” PS3 PKG download from unofficial sources directly implicates a range of copyright concerns. Copyright law grants exclusive rights to the creators and publishers of intellectual property, including video games. Distributing and downloading copyrighted material without authorization constitutes a violation of these rights, exposing individuals to potential legal repercussions.

  • Infringement of Distribution Rights

    Copyright law grants the copyright holder, typically the game developer or publisher, the exclusive right to distribute copies of their work. Uploading a “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file to a file-sharing website or downloading it from such a source without permission infringes upon this right. This unauthorized distribution is a direct violation of copyright law, regardless of whether the distributor profits from the activity.

  • Infringement of Reproduction Rights

    Downloading a “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file creates an unauthorized copy of the game on the user’s device. Copyright law reserves the right to reproduce a copyrighted work exclusively for the copyright holder. Making an unauthorized copy, even for personal use, is a form of copyright infringement. This principle applies even if the user already owns a legitimate physical copy of the game.

  • Circumvention of Technological Protection Measures

    PlayStation 3 consoles employ technological protection measures (TPMs) to prevent unauthorized copying and distribution of games. If a user modifies their console to bypass these TPMs in order to install a downloaded “Fight Night Round 4” PKG file, they may be in violation of laws that prohibit the circumvention of copyright protection technologies. These laws aim to prevent individuals from circumventing safeguards designed to protect copyrighted works.

  • Potential Legal Ramifications

    Copyright infringement can result in various legal consequences, ranging from civil lawsuits to criminal charges. Copyright holders can sue infringers for monetary damages, including lost profits and statutory damages. In some cases, large-scale copyright infringement may lead to criminal prosecution, resulting in fines and even imprisonment. While individual downloaders are less likely to face criminal charges, they may still be subject to civil lawsuits from copyright holders seeking compensation for the unauthorized use of their work.

These copyright concerns underscore the legal and ethical implications of seeking a “Fight Night Round 4” PS3 PKG download from unofficial channels. The act of downloading and using such a file constitutes a violation of copyright law and exposes users to potential legal risks. Supporting legitimate distribution platforms and respecting intellectual property rights is crucial for fostering a sustainable and ethical gaming ecosystem. The alternative jeopardizes the rights of creators and publishers while potentially exposing the user to legal and financial repercussions.
